REVIEW ON TASTE MASKING OF BITTER DRUGS BY USING ION EXCHANGE RESIN METHOD
More Komal V.*, Bidkar Shital J., Naykodi Pradnya S. and Dighe Ajinkya D.
Abstract The masking of bitter drugs is now a days top most priority of pharmaceutical companies in order to improve the poor taste and palatability. The various organoleptic properties such as taste, smell, texture, also these are important factor in development of oral dosage form. The taste is major factor of patient compliance and product quality. Acceptability of any dosage form mainly depends over its taste i.e. mouth feel. Drug molecules interact with taste receptor on the tongue to give bitter, sweet or other taste sensation of taste by single transduction of receptor organs.
